返回上一页 如何让新网站快速被搜索引擎收录的方法 网站建设公司资讯 网站内容建设和网站点击率—— 中小型网站优化

当前位置:首页 > 观点资讯 > 网站建设 > 详细内容

网页框架架构

时间:23-03-30 浏览:207次 + 打印

大多数Web应用程序框架的基础上的模型 - 视图 - 控制器(MVC)架构模式。

网页框架架构

模型 - 视图 - 控制器(MVC)的许多框架遵循,模型 - 视图 - 控制器(MVC)架构模式的数据模型,业务规则从用户界面分开。这被普遍认为是一个很好的做法,因为它模块化的代码,促进代码重用,并允许将应用于多个接口。在Web应用程序,允许不同的意见提出,如网页,对于人类来说,Web服务接口远程应用。

基于推 - 拉 MVC框架遵循推式架构。使用这些框架的行动,做必要的处理,然后“推”数据视图层渲染的结果。Django,Ruby on Rails的,symfony中,Yii的和Spring MVC的Struts这个架构很好的例子。这是拉式的建筑,有时也被称为“基于组件”。这些框架的视图层,然后可以“拉”,从多个控制器需要启动。在这个架构中,可以涉及多个控制器与一个单一的视图。播放,电梯,挂毯,检票和条纹拉架构的例子。

三层architectureIn三层架构,应用程序是围绕三个物理层结构:客户端,应用程序和数据库。数据库通常是一个RDBMS。应用程序中包含的业务逻辑,在服务器上运行,并与客户端使用HTTP进行通信。Web应用程序的客户端,Web浏览器中运行的HTML应用层产生。在三层结构不同,被认为是一个很好的做法,继续从业务逻辑控制器,MVC中的“中间层”。

内容管理系统

历来被称为内容管理系统的一些项目已经开始采取更高层次的Web应用程序框架的角色。例如,Drupal的结构提供了一个小的核心,通过提供一般Web应用程序框架相关的功能模块,扩展其功能。在Joomla平台提供了一组API来构建Web和命令行应用程序。然而,它是有争议的“内容管理”是否是这种系统的主要价值,尤其是当有些像的SilverStripe,提供一个面向对象的MVC框架。添加模块,现在使这些系统功能全面应用,内容管理的范围之外。他们可能提供的API功能,功能框架,编码标准,和许多传统Web应用程序框架相关的功能。

      南京网站建设公司-小宇宙(www.zncas.com.),拥有设计团队为企业提供FLASH网站设计网页制作多媒体触摸屏展示设计.

网站建设公司项目经理

扫二维码与项目经理沟通

我们在微信上24小时期待你的声音
解答:网站优化、网站建设、APP开发、小程序开发

如有侵权需要删除文章请联系我

小宇宙是一家以提供网站建设网站优化APP开发小程序开发、网络营销推广为主的互联网开发公司。以客户需求为导向,客户利益为出发点,结合自身设计及专业建站优势,为客户提供从基础建设到营销推广的一整套解决方案,探索并实现客户商业价值较大化,为所有谋求长远发展的企业贡献全部力量。

Learn more

关于我们 专业网站设计制作

Learn more

服务项目 南京网站建设
获取网站设计、app开发、VI设计报价 微信客服 返回顶部
网站制作
扫二维码与项目经理沟通
×

Let\'s get in touch!,login get more service.

我们将艺术与技术相结合,用创意和设计为客户创造商业价值,创造优秀的产品及服务体验!登陆之后可以获得更多的私人定制服务

sitemap.txt sitemap.xml sitemap.htm 网站设计制作